What is Desiccated Coconut?
Desiccated coconut is the “meat” of the coconut that is shredded or flaked and dried. I use desiccated coconut in this recipe, alternatively of sweetened flaked or sweetened shredded coconut. The key variance is that it is unsweetened. The other distinction is its shredded scaled-down that normal flaked coconut. I want the desiccated coconut in this recipe, as the smaller shreds give a much better texture in the balls. The shreds are not rather as very long which will help hold the balls alongside one another a little easier, and make a a little denser ball. If you don’t have desiccated coconut, you can simply just pulse frequent coconut flakes in the foods processor a couple moments, building a equivalent final result. Think of is like the big difference among swift oats and old-fashioned oats.


How To Make Coconut Balls/Recommendations:
- Divide the coconut in 50 %. Performing in batches insert 50 percent the coconut into a substantial nonstick skillet. Warmth in excess of medium-minimal heat till golden and toasted, stirring routinely. Once the coconut is toasted, transfer it to a significant baking sheet to cool. Repeat with the remaining coconut.
- When the coconut is cooled, reserve 1/3 cup of the coconut and area in a small bowl for rolling. Established aside.
- In a substantial bowl blend the remaining coconut, sweetened condensed milk, and brown sugar and stir to blend evenly.
- Applying a modest cookie scoop (1 tablespoon) sized cookie scoop, portion out the mixture and form into restricted ball 1-inch balls – 1 1/2-inch in diameter. Roll the coconut ball in the reserved toasted coconut and set on a parchment lined sheet to established. Repeat with the remaining mixture.
- Allow for the balls to set up at room temperature for an hour and then transfer to an airtight container to store.
How to Retailer:
These coconut balls retailer splendidly. Store them airtight for up to a 7 days at room temperature or up to 2 months in the fridge. They also freeze fantastic to make in advance. Just shop them in the freezer in an airtight container for up to 2 months. Thaw them at room temperature.
